Calibration
70
Note: Calibrations must be performed by trained personnel. Incorrectly
set parameters may result in errors in sample measurements.
Note: To reduce the response time of the probes, briefly stir the buffer
solution with the probe and then hold it still.
8.1.1.1
Calibration with automatic buffer recognition
The buffer solutions selected in the configure menu (
) must be used during calibration for accurate results. Other
buffer solutions, even those with the same nominal pH values, may
show a different temperature dependence and result in measurement
errors.
Complete the following steps to calibrate the pH probe:
1. Press
CAL
, enter passcode: 1100,
ENTER
. The display will show
CAL1.
2. Remove the pH and temperature probes from the process. Clean
the probes and immerse in the first buffer solution (any order).
Briefly stir the solution with the probes.
3. Press
ENTER
. Automatic recognition of the buffer solution will begin.
The display will first show the hourglass and no buffer value, then
the recognized buffer value followed by the measured millivolt
value. When the measurement is complete, the display will show
CAL2.
4. When CAL2 is displayed, remove the probes from the first buffer
solution and rinse thoroughly.
5. Complete a one-point calibration or start a two-point calibration:
•
One-point calibration: press
CAL
to end the calibration. The
slope (%) and offset (mV) of the probe (based on 25 °C) will be
displayed.
•
Two-point calibration: immerse the probes in the second buffer
solution. Press
ENTER
